A tool box and trolley is a combination of a storage container (tool box) and a mobile platform (trolley) designed to organise, transport, and protect tools efficiently. In simple terms, it’s a practical, portable workstation that helps tradespeople, DIY enthusiasts, and hobbyists keep their tools secure while allowing easy movement across workshops, garages, and job sites.

Types or Styles of Tool Boxes and Trolleys
Tool boxes and trolleys come in several styles in Australia, each catering to different needs, storage capacities, and mobility requirements:
1. Rolling Tool Chest
-
Multi-drawer units mounted on wheels
-
Large storage for power tools and hand tools
-
Often made from steel or durable aluminium
2. Modular Tool Boxes
-
Stackable boxes that click together
-
Customisable compartments for small tools and accessories
-
Portable sections for home or workshop use
3. Plastic Tool Boxes
-
Lightweight, budget-friendly, ideal for light-duty tools
-
Integrated handles and compartments
-
Suitable for DIYers and hobbyists
4. Metal Tool Boxes
-
Heavy-duty steel or aluminium construction
-
Lockable drawers for security
-
Ideal for professional tradespeople
5. Trolley Workstations
-
Combines tool storage with a flat work surface
-
Can include bins, trays, or pegboards
-
Perfect for mobile tasks in workshops, garages, or construction sites
6. Outdoor/Portable Tool Trolleys
-
Weather-resistant materials
-
Compact for transportation in vehicles
-
Useful for garden tools, automotive kits, or on-site repairs

How to Choose a Tool Box and Trolley
Choosing the right tool box and trolley involves considering size, durability, mobility, and your specific needs. Here’s a practical guide:
1. Assess Storage Requirements
-
Count the number and size of tools you own
-
Include hand tools, power tools, and accessories
-
Larger workshops may need multi-drawer steel units
2. Choose the Right Material
-
Plastic: lightweight and portable, good for small DIY tasks
-
Steel/Aluminium: durable, secure, long-lasting, ideal for tradespeople
-
Combination Units: blend lightweight mobility with reinforced storage
3. Mobility Features
-
Lockable wheels for stability
-
Swivel or fixed casters for manoeuvrability
-
Handles or foldable platforms for easier transport
